About the Role
As an administrator, you will ensure the school's warm, welcoming and friendly ethos is extended to all visitors and guests. You will be working under the direction of our wonderful Office Manager to help the school office run as efficiently and effectively as possible.
Key Responsibilities
• Front desk & enquiries
• Monitoring and responding to emails and telephone calls
• Maintain filing systems during and end of year
• Archive files when requested by SBM
• Support SBM with VAT submittals to GCC, filing BACS and ad hoc requests
• Support Office Manager with In-Year and Year-End file transfer
• Maintain staff training spreadsheet
• Record morning and afternoon attendance
• Process term time absence requests
• Liaise with parents
• Report attendance concerns to pastoral lead
• Report absences to class teachers
• Record daily lunch charges and set up all payment items for trips and events
• Monitor overdue balance and liaise with parents and staff as necessary
• Set up and share pupil account letters with parents as required
• Support parents with ParentPay queries
• Monitor stationery levels
• Raise stationery, cleaning and general order requisitions
• Place orders
• Checking delivery of goods, arranging returns as required
• Request COSHH Sheets as necessary & file
• Input orders when requested to do so
• Banking as required
• Manage order requisitions for petty cash
• Administer claims and issue petty cash as required
• Processing on FMS
• Replenish as required
• Administer medication and liaise with parents as required
• Maintain medication records
• Monitor pupil medication kept onsite
